The global tungsten carbide tool industry is witnessing a shift towards micro-machining and Industry 4.0 integration. As electronics become smaller and more complex, the need for engraving cutters with tip diameters as small as 0.1mm is growing. Furthermore, the push for "Green Machining" means that global enterprises are prioritizing manufacturers who use sustainable sintering processes and offer tool recycling programs.

Based in the industrial heart of Sichuan, we utilize a 5-axis CNC gear grinding infrastructure that matches German precision at a significantly optimized cost structure. Our efficiency comes from:
Blending carbide and cobalt with aviation gasoline for molecular uniformity.
Removing solvents to create a pure, high-density powder mixture.
Hydraulic molding ensuring exact blank geometry for Swedish specs.
Vacuum heat treatment at 1400°C+ to reach maximum hardness.
Precise gear opening and flute grinding using world-class machines.
Rigorous micro-meter testing for sub-micron accuracy.
